Adamawa gov poll: PDP alleges plot to tamper with results, as Binani pleads for review of results by INEC

The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) has alleged plots to tamper with already collated results of the March 18 governorship election in Adamawa State.

The party accused the All Progressives Congress (APC) and some officials of the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) of being behind the plot.

The Informant247 earlier reported that INEC suspended further release of the election results following the cancellation of election results from some 69 polling units in one local government, while fixing April 15 for supplementary election in the affected units.

At a briefing in Abuja on Monday, the PDP National Publicity Secretary, Debo Ologunagba, said the PDP candidate, Governor Ahmadu Fintiri was leading his APC challenger, Senator Aisha Binani with 31,299 votes as already declared by INEC, while also alleged that some APC chieftains and INEC officials had earlier attempted to move the collation of the Adamawa election from Yola to Abuja for the purpose of manipulation.

“It has come to the knowledge of our party that the APC and its candidate, having realized that they cannot defeat Governor Fintiri in the 69 polling units, given his popularity and determination of the people, are now putting pressure on INEC to alter already collated and declared results in other polling units where no cases of malpractice or disruption of election took place.

“The PDP alerts the people of Adamawa of fresh plots by the APC, its hired agents and compromised officials of INEC to alter and cancel the already declared results in 21 Local Government Areas where elections have been concluded and declared.

“This is part of APC’s plot to facilitate the manipulation and/or alteration of the already declared results in favour of the APC candidate against the expressed Will of the people.’’

Meanwhile, The All Progressives Congress (APC) gubernatorial candidate in Adamawa State, Sen. Aishatu Dahiru Ahmed (Binani) has demanded equity, fairness and justice from the Independent National Electoral Commission(INEC) on the governorship poll results.

Binani asked INEC to review the election results of the 18″ March Governorship election in a number of Local Government Areas in Adamawa State, while also calling for the total cancellation of the election results in Fufore Local Government Area.

She said if election reviews were conducted in Enugu, Abia and Doguwa Constituency in Kano State, Adamawa should not be left out.

Binani, who made her position known in a statement in Abuja said she had petitioned INEC to press home her demands.

The statement said: “My Lawyer has submitted a petition to the Chairman of the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C), Prof. Mahmood Yakubu calling for a review of the election results of the 18” March Governorship election in a number of Local Government Areas in Adamawa State.

“We are aware INEC ordered reviews for Abia and Enugu Governorship results. A similar review was also done in Doguwa Constituency in Kano State in line with Section 65 of the Electoral Act 2022.

“My Lawyer has similarly applied to the commission for a Certified True Copy of the Bio-modal Verification Authentication System (BVAS) used for 18” March, 2023 for Adamawa State elections.

“This is as a result of series of actions of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), the Governor of Adamawa, and other persons in disrupting the elections, causing violence, tearing of result sheets, intimidation and harassment of both voters and INEC officials, non-accreditation of thousands of voters by non-use of BVAS, fraudulent upload of state Assembly Constituency results on Governorship IREV, beating of some APC returning officers which caused the hospitalization in Yola of Mallam Ahmadu .J. Hausa, Ward Chairman of Songgari for four days.”

On Fufore Local Government Area, Binani asked for a total cancelation of results from the Local Government Area.

She added: “There was also the collation of results at the Police Station in Fufore to favour PDP under duress. We therefore call for total cancellation of results from the Local Government Area.

“The case for Adamawa State is not in any way different from places where reviews were undertaken.

”lt is for this reason that | am asking for equity, fairness and justice as guaranteed by the 2022 Electoral Act and the Constitution of the Federal Republic of Nigeria.”
